In Malaysia, condensation inside flexible ducts often leads to the growth of mold and bacteria. Antimicrobial liners act as an active defense layer.
Active Pathogen Inhibition: We utilize liners embedded with Silver-Ion ($Ag^+$) or Zinc-Pyrithione technology. These agents disrupt the metabolic processes of fungi, bacteria, and mold on contact, preventing the formation of bio-films that can block airflow and degrade the duct material.
Preventing "Bio-Fouling" Resistance: When mold grows inside a flex duct, it creates a "carpet" of resistance that increases static pressure. By keeping the inner core mirror-smooth, we ensure the "Specific Fan Power" (SFP) remains low. This allows your Variable Frequency Drives (VFDs) to operate at lower hertz, directly improving your Building Energy Index (BEI).
Non-Shedding Integrity: Unlike older fiberglass-lined ducts, our antimicrobial liners are made of non-porous polymers or coated aluminum. This ensures that no fibers or chemical agents shed into the air stream, satisfying the highest clinical IAQ standards.

Our antimicrobial flex ducts feature a high-tensile spring steel wire helix encapsulated between layers of treated polymer. This is encased in R-6.0 High-Density Insulation with a reinforced vapor jacket. This "closed-cell" approach prevents the moisture migration that typically fuels microbial growth in ceiling voids.
The connection between the flex duct and the diffuser is the most vulnerable point. We utilize Antimicrobial Mastic Sealant on the inner core before applying Dual-Clamping Protocols. This creates a 100% airtight, biologically sealed transition that eliminates "Pressure Bleed" and contaminant entry.
To prevent "sedimentation" of particulates where mold could take root, we strictly limit flex runs to a maximum of 2.5 meters. By keeping the ducts taut and correctly radiused with Rigid Elbow Supports, we ensure air moves fast enough to stay clean and energy-efficient.
